B.J. retained Ms. Condello to defend him on six charges of Criminal Mischief damage to property for writing in permanent ink at a bus station.  The client saw graffiti of a swastika and wrote next it “Jesus is Lord”.   Police identified the client and determined that the client was also responsible for graffiti of swastikas.  The Crown screened the matter as a hate crime and was seeking jail.  Ms. Condello was able to show through circumstantial evidence that the client was not the person responsible for the hate crime writings and was trying to counter the hate writing with Christian values and not hate.  The client paid restitution for damages caused by his writing only and the charges were all withdrawn.
